Understanding Intervals and the Major Scale

An interval refers to the distance between two notes, measured in terms of the number of semitones separating them. Intervals are classified based on their size and quality, with major, minor, perfect, and augmented intervals being the most common. The major scale, also known as the Ionian mode, is a seven-note scale characterized by its specific intervallic structure. It consists of a pattern of whole steps (W) and half steps (H): W-W-H-W-W-W-H. This pattern creates a distinct sound and provides a framework for understanding the relationships between notes within the scale.

Analyzing Intervals in the Major Scale

To analyze the intervals within the major scale, we can start by examining the relationships between the root note (the first note of the scale) and each subsequent note. The interval between the root and the second note is a major second, consisting of two semitones. The interval between the root and the third note is a major third, consisting of four semitones. This pattern continues, with each interval increasing in size until we reach the octave, which is an interval of twelve semitones.
